Types of Vehicles Available

Not all “limos” are the long, stretched vehicles you might picture. Modern limo services offer several options:

  • Sedan/Town Car – Perfect for 1-3 passengers, often a Lincoln or Cadillac
  • SUV – Accommodates 5-6 passengers with luggage
  • Stretch Limousine – The classic option, seating 6-10 passengers
  • Stretch SUV – More headroom than traditional stretch limos, seats 12-16
  • Sprinter Van – Great for group airport transfers, seats 10-14
  • Party Bus – For large celebrations, can fit 20+ passengers

Each vehicle type serves different needs. For airport pickups, sedans or SUVs usually make more sense. For weddings or proms, stretch options add that special touch. For corporate events with multiple executives, a Sprinter might be the most practical choice.

When to Book Your Limo

One mistake many people make is waiting too long to reserve their transportation. During peak seasons, the best vehicles get booked quickly.

For weddings or proms, book 3-6 months ahead. These events often fall during busy seasons when demand is high. For business travel or airport service, try to book at least a week in advance. Last-minute bookings are possible but limit your options and might cost more.

Holiday seasons, graduation weekends, and major city events can make booking even tighter. If your event falls near Christmas, New Year’s Eve, or during a major convention in Seattle, earlier is definitely better.

Understanding Pricing Factors

Limo pricing isn’t always straightforward. Several factors affect what you’ll pay:

  • Vehicle type and size
  • Day of week (weekends cost more)
  • Time of day (late night services often have higher rates)
  • Duration of service
  • Distance covered
  • Season and demand
  • Additional services requested

Many companies charge by the hour with minimum booking requirements. For special events like weddings, expect a 3-5 hour minimum. Airport transfers might have flat rates for certain areas.

Watch out for hidden costs. Ask specifically about:

  • Fuel surcharges
  • Gratuity (often 15-20% added automatically)
  • Parking fees
  • Toll charges
  • Late night/early morning fees
  • Holiday surcharges

Getting these details upfront prevents surprise charges on your final bill.

Questions to Ask Before Booking

Before confirming your reservation, ask these questions:

  • Is gratuity included in the price?
  • What happens if my flight is delayed? (for airport service)
  • What’s your cancellation policy?
  • Can I see photos of the actual vehicle I’ll be getting?
  • Is there a contract I need to sign?
  • What amenities are included? (water, WiFi, etc.)
  • How will the driver be dressed?
  • What happens if the vehicle breaks down?
  • How much time is built in for unexpected delays?

Good companies will have clear answers ready. Vague responses might be a red flag.

What to Expect on the Day of Service

A professional chauffeur typically arrives 10-15 minutes early. For airport pickups, they’ll track your flight and adjust for delays. Many companies now offer text updates when your driver is en route or waiting.

The vehicle should be clean inside and out. Basic amenities like bottled water are standard with most services. Higher-end packages might include champagne, snacks, or special decorations for occasions like weddings.

Your chauffeur should help with luggage and door opening. They’ll confirm your destination and preferred route. Most will also ask about temperature preferences and music.
